The top BBA colleges in Dubai for international students include SP Jain School of Global Management, Amity University Dubai, University of Wollongong in Dubai, and Hult University. These institutions are known for strong academic standards, global recognition, and industry connections, making them popular choices for international learners.
For BBA in Dubai, Indian students generally need to complete Class 12 with at least 60% marks. Specific requirements differ by university: SP Jain requires 60% and IELTS 6, Amity University Dubai requires 60% in Class 12, and UOWD requires 65% in CBSE/ICSE with IELTS 6.0. These criteria ensure students are prepared academically and have good English proficiency.
The BBA in Dubai fees vary based on the university and programme. SP Jain charges AED 31,000 for January intake and AED 29,700 for September intake. Amity University Dubai charges AED 21,00 per credit. UOWD fees are AED 60,429 for Spring 2026 and AED 63,449 for Autumn 2026, while Hult University charges AED 153,000. In addition, students should also consider the cost of living Dubai, which includes accommodation, food, transport and personal expenses.
Yes, study in Dubai with scholarship options are available for Indian students. For example, UOWD offers academic merit scholarships ranging from 15% to 50% per trimester, while Hult University provides merit-based scholarships that are automatically considered during admission. These Dubai university scholarship opportunities can significantly reduce tuition costs and make studying more affordable.
Most BBA in Dubai programmes are 3 years long, though some universities offer 4-year options. SP Jain offers a 4-year BBA programme, Amity University Dubai offers 3 to 4-year options, and UOWD provides both 3-year and 4-year programmes. This flexibility helps students choose a duration that best suits their career goals.
For BBA admissions, Dubai student visa requirements typically include confirmation of admission from a recognised university and completion of necessary documentation. Students also need to meet the university’s eligibility criteria and follow the visa application process.
